About Smart Barre
Smart Barre practices concentrated movements that function as deep sculpting tools to strengthen and lengthen muscles. As a total body workout, this class fuses principles of ballet, Pilates, and yoga to target body areas in which women struggle- the core, hips, thighs, seat and arms. What Is the Cost of Living Near Fort Worth?

Understanding the cost of living near Fort Worth is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Smart Barre.
Fort Worth's Cost of Living Index is approximately 97.3 (2.7% less expensive than US average; 4.6% more than TX average). 'Cowtown', Dallas's sister city, more affordable housing. Trinity Metro. When planning your budget based on a salary from Smart Barre,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,100 - $1,600+ A significant portion of Smart Barre sal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$250 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$80 (Trinity Metro mon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$390 - $570 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$380 - $700+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$370 - $690+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,470 - $3,810+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
